DETROIT (Aug. 2, 2022) – Detroit Public Television’s Board of Trustees recently elected Dan Duggan, the vice president of loan origination at Bernard Financial Group, as one of its newest members.

“We are honored to have such a credentialed business professional as Dan on our board,” said Rich Homberg, president and CEO of Detroit Public Television (DPTV). “With his insight, skills and proven history in finance and executive-level media, he will be a key contributor to our mission and will provide invaluable guidance in our efforts to promote and energize our work in Detroit and throughout Southeast Michigan.”

In his role as vice president, Duggan has originated more than $300 million in loans. He also serves as a mentor to new brokers and an advisor to the ownership of the firm on key issues. Bernard Financial is Michigan’s largest commercial mortgage banking firm, offering financing for all asset classes of investment real estate.

Duggan came on board with the Bernard Financial Group after more than a decade of executive-level media experience. He was editor-in-chief of the Illinois Real Estate Journal, a commercial real estate publication in Chicago, before returning home to Detroit, where he assumed real estate coverage for Crain’s Detroit Business. He was later promoted to lead all revenue-producing special projects. In this role, he created product lines for live events, webinars and print publications, efforts that typically surpassed $1 million in profits annually. Additionally, he took on special projects on behalf of the Crain family, which generated revenue across multiple Crain publications.

Currently, Duggan is also serving on the Troy Community Foundation as Treasurer. The community foundation is a nonprofit which raises funds and manages endowments to benefit the Troy community through grants and charitable support. Additionally, he is serving a two-year term on the board of directors for Michigan’s Commercial Board of REALTORS and is chair of the programming committee.

Dan holds a real estate sales license in the state of Michigan. He also contracts with various local and national events and medi    a publications as a public speaker on real estate and finance topics.

He is an alumnus of Michigan State University, a fifth generation of his family to call metro Detroit his home, and a member of Temple Emanu-El in Oak Park.

Outside the office, Duggan enjoys spending quality time with his wife and three children. He and his family reside in Troy.

 

About Detroit Public TV

Serving Southeast Michigan, Detroit Public TV (DPTV) is Michigan’s largest and most watched television station, with the most diverse public television audience in the country. DPTV is the state’s only community-licensed station, meaning it operates independently of any educational or government institution. Each week, more than two million people watch DPTV’s five broadcast channels, and nearly 200,000 people listen to its radio station, 90.9 WRCJ, for classical days and jazzy nights. In addition, DPTV is building the next generation of public media with a rapidly growing digital presence, which now reaches more than half a million unique visitors through its website, YouTube channels and social media platforms each month.
